What makes it 89% Baby-Friendly: Babies ride free on tours, paths allow personal or rented strollers, a staffed nursing room and many changing tables aid caregivers, but hills and heat mean planning shaded pauses.
Why 4-8 hours visit duration is ideal for with baby: Allows time for key exhibits and paced breaks for baby
Self-guided Botanical Tours:
Follow stroller-friendly paths through themed gardens and indoor greenhouses.
Tip: Pick up a free brochure at Tickets & Tours. Use shaded indoor routes when baby naps.
Wildlife Presentations:
Attend short animal shows with live ambassadors and keep baby engaged.
Tip: Arrive 5 minutes early to get front-row seating near aisles for quick exits.
Wildlife Explorers Basecamp:
Let baby explore soft-surface play areas and indoor reptile house.
Tip: Bring a small blanket for floor play and visit during cooler morning hours.
Guided Bus Tour:
Enjoy a 35-minute narrated ride with stroller parked nearby.
Tip: Board early to secure a window seat. Keep baby on lap and bring snacks.
Skyfari Aerial Tram:
Glide over treetops for zoo and park views.
Tip: Fold stroller to under 23″. Choose a center car for stable ride with baby.

In spring, enjoy blooming gardens on the botanical tour. In summer, start mornings in indoor greenhouses to beat heat. Winter visits mean fewer crowds and mild weather.
